Christine Bovill at OranMor
1 November, 2018, 7.30 p.m.
Award winning chanteuse, Christine Bovill returns for her seventh visit to Òran Mór. The Glasgow-born singer has built her reputation on her interpretation of classic 20th century songs. With the release of Derby Street and The Sentence That I Serve she revealed a major talent as a songwriter.
Fresh from an international theatre tour and sell out Edinburgh Fringe run, with both her Piaf and Paris shows, Christine will perform an intimate evening of song. Expect a vibrant and original collection of bittersweet ballads, alongside infectious jazz and Cajun sounds- all bound together by her remarkable voice.
“Bovill is a great storyteller and she brings the songs to life with terrific panache and dramatic flair.” – The Scotsman
“ Something that will stay with you for the rest of your life….I wasn’t prepared for the effect her voice would have on me.” – Sunday Times
